Output 34bd3d98a038f30e7cda36f69cd3f1df4b9a965f42b3a6cbbb4af1852fc4d1cd:2

value
324260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dd07b01b337912f570e6f9e3a5283ef074d6a76 OP_EQUAL
address
3AF4WrzP4kxsrxxMt1UD1ZBWhyLdMVzrA6
transaction
34bd3d98a038f30e7cda36f69cd3f1df4b9a965f42b3a6cbbb4af1852fc4d1cd
confirmations
128365
spent
true